Reviews the quality of instructions and guidance provided to agents. Good implementation is clear, handles edge cases, and produces reliable results.

The body is a comprehensive, well-structured, and highly concrete reference manual that gives Claude what it needs to answer user questions about HanaAgent. Its weaknesses are significant redundancy (the tips section and FAQ restate earlier content) and the absence of any progressive disclosure into separate reference files despite the document's length.

Suggestions

Remove or collapse section 十四 (实用技巧), since nearly every tip duplicates content already covered in sections 二–十一; cross-reference instead of restating.

Split the long-tail detail (Yuan cognitive frameworks, theme list, full FAQ) into one-level-deep reference files under references/ and link to them from SKILL.md to improve progressive disclosure.

Trim conversational/marketing prose (e.g. '住在你电脑里的伙伴', the OpenClaw comparison table) to leaner reference phrasing that assumes the reader's competence.

Based on the skill's description, can an agent find and select it at the right time? Clear, specific descriptions lead to better discovery.

The description is strong: it states what the skill does, provides a comprehensive bilingual set of natural trigger terms, and gives explicit 'when to use' guidance in third person. Its main weakness is that the 'what' is expressed as question categories rather than concrete actions.
